Cop sees sister's shooting

2007-12-26 15:59

Johannesburg - A man shot his girlfriend in front of her sister, a Johannesburg metro police officer in Diepkloof, Chief Superintendent Wayne Minnaar said on Wednesday.

The metro police officer was helping her sister fetch her bags from her security guard boyfriend's home on Tuesday after they broke up following an argument, he said.

However, once inside the house, the man locked his ex-girlfriend in a room with him. Realising he was armed, the metro policewoman forced the door open.

Minnaar said the man took out a firearm and shot his ex-girlfriend twice in her upper body then turned the gun on her sister, but she managed to get away unharmed. She returned with back-up to find her sister dead.

The gunman was tracked to his work address in Rivonia where he was arrested.

He had since been taken to Diepkloof Police Station and charged with murder and attempted murder.

He would be kept in the police station's holding cells until his appearance in the Protea Magistrate's Court. It was not yet known when he would appear in court, said Minnaar.

- SAPA
